The Rocca di Montemassi Syrosa is a delightful rosé wine from Tuscany, crafted primarily from Syrah grapes. This wine combines a soft pink colour with a refreshing taste, making it perfect for enjoyable sipping on warm days. With an early harvest and careful pressing, you can appreciate its delicate tannins and pale hue. The fermentation in steel vats ensures a crisp and vibrant profile, while the five-month ageing process adds depth to its flavours, enhancing your overall tasting experience.

The Castillo de Ibiza Rosé is crafted from Tempranillo and Garnacha grapes, separately vinified using the saignée method to enhance flavour. You’ll appreciate the cold maceration process, which helps draw out delicate aromas and gives the wine its subtle pink hue, making it visually appealing. After maceration, the skins are removed and fermentation takes place at a controlled temperature of around 15°C, ensuring a fresh and balanced taste. This wine presents a pale, vibrant pink colour with peach tones, perfect for those who enjoy a crisp and refreshing rosé.
